Members of the Lords offer condolences to visiting Taiwanese legislators after Hualien earthquake

Following the strong earthquake which struck Hualien in the late evening on February 6, Lord Faulkner of Worcester, the UK Prime Minister’s Trade Envoy to Taiwan, and Baroness Anelay, Deputy Speaker of the House of Lords, expressed their condolences in a meeting with Representative David Lin as well as Taiwanese legislators Yu Mei-Nu and Yu Wan-Ju from the Democratic Progressive Party (DPP) on February 8.
On behalf of the Taiwanese government, Representative Lin thanked both members of the Lords for their warmth and friendship. He also stated that he would relay their sentiments to Taipei immediately.
The meeting was held in London at the Taipei Representative Office (TRO). The two Deputy Speakers of the House of Lords also discussed ways to promote exchange between Taiwan and the UK in the future with Representative Lin and the DPP officials.
